On time-variable BP neural network with application in body-bio-model tracking

2010 
A novel structure with time-memory function and time-shift terms of dynamic BP neural network (NDBP) using process-tracking training-algorithm based on the system-identification and statistic theory is developed in the CAD-grid 2# (China-Austria-Data-Grid-cooperation-project) and CEFSP 2008 5# (Chinese Education Foundation Science Project). This NDBP is used specially for real-time modeling for tracking the strong-time-variable dynamic process. Owing to its memory- and forgetting- ability, the newer output errors strongly effect the weight-correction. Both advantages, robust process-function approach and high speed process-characterisytic tracking, are possessed by the NDBP facing the urgent requirement of the research fields such as bio-chemical-process analysis, on-line diagnosis medical measurement, industrial adaptive process control, nature synusiologic development monitoring, and so on. The basic principle, algorithm composition and description, execution effect and typical application in medical measurement are introduced. The entire algorithem is supported by the newly developped Cloud-computing system.
